Made a new system of spinner.
see video https://www.youtube.com/watch?v=XfVvqdrHeaE
Needs bearings 696 (6x15x5mm) - 4pcs
M3x14mm bolt - 4 pcs
self-locking nut M3 - 4 pcs
balls 22mm -3pcs
(or you can take 7/8" (22.225mm) balls and print outer ring +08mm)
need to be printed:
frame A, frame B, roller - 3pcs, cap A, cap B, and outer ring.
I printed outer ring +06mm - with tolerance 0.6mm,
maybe you will need +0.4mm or +0.8mm - dont know...
with balls 7/8" print +0.8mm.
AND NEED A LOT OF GOOD SANDING for outer ring,
so that the inner surface is perfectly smooth.
In openscad you can try use other models of bearings and balls, but with 608 nothing will work out - too big. Openscad file supports animation.
So that the bearings 696 are correctly drawn, you need to replace the standard file from the library MCAD with the bearing.scad
Аналог для подшипников 696 - это 1000096.
Если с ошкуриванием перестараетесь, то можно вместо шаров 22мм поставить 22,225мм.
